What is deep tissue facial massage?
Deep tissue facial massage is a type of massage that focuses on the deeper layers of the skin and the muscles underneath. This technique uses firmer pressure and slower strokes than traditional facial massage. The goal is to break up tension and tightness in the facial muscles, which can cause wrinkles, sagging, and other signs of aging.
How does it work?
During a deep tissue facial massage, the therapist will use their hands, fingers, and sometimes even elbows to apply pressure to specific areas of the face. They will target the muscles that are responsible for facial expressions like frowning or squinting. By releasing tension in these muscles, the therapist can help to smooth out wrinkles and fine lines.
What are the benefits?
There are many benefits to deep tissue facial massage. Here are just a few:
1. Increased circulation
Deep tissue massage can help to increase blood flow to the face, which can bring more nutrients and oxygen to the skin. This can help to give the skin a healthy glow and can even improve the complexion over time.
2. Reduced puffiness
By improving circulation and lymphatic drainage, deep tissue facial massage can also help to reduce puffiness in the face. This is especially helpful for people who have under-eye bags or swollen cheeks.
3. Improved skin elasticity
The pressure and stretching involved in deep tissue facial massage can help to stimulate collagen production, which can improve the skin's elasticity and firmness. This can help to reduce sagging and wrinkles.
4. Stress relief
Facial massage can be incredibly relaxing, and deep tissue massage is no exception. By releasing tension in the facial muscles, this type of massage can help to relieve stress and promote relaxation.

What to expect during a deep tissue facial massage?
During a deep tissue facial massage, you can expect to lie down on a massage table and have your face, neck, and shoulders massaged. The therapist will use a variety of techniques, including kneading, tapping, and stretching. You may feel some discomfort during the massage, especially if you have a lot of tension in your facial muscles. However, the therapist should always check in with you to make sure you are comfortable.
